11 Things 20-Year-Olds Should Be Doing

Your 20’s are some of the most important years of your life. You start to find out who you really are, what you like, and how you want to spend the rest of your life. It’s important to not waste these years, to spend them productively and to start keeping yourself healthy both physically and emotionally.

1. Reduce your spending.

These are the years that are important to start creating smart spending habits – deciding what you need versus what you want, saying no to the everyday $6 latté at Starbucks, or the newest accessory that you think you can’t live without. Building a savings account is so important when starting your adult years, so why not start sooner rather than later?

2. Seriously think about your career.

This is a really good time to start thinking about what you really want to be doing for the rest of your life and make sure it is something that makes you happy.

3. Travel.

Take this time to go see the places you’ve always wanted to see. Backpack through Europe with a group of your closest friends, or take a year off and travel the world. It’s such a great time to do it, so take advantage of it.

4. Be kind to strangers.


It is incredibly important to develop a positive attitude, not only towards your everyday life, but also toward people that you surround yourself with. Be nice to strangers; smile as they pass you on the street. Help someone carry their bags when they’re struggling, just because you can. This positivity and kindness will overflow into your other relationships and help you lead a more positive and healthy life.

5. Work out and eat healthy.

You and your body are in prime condition during this time to work on getting healthy! It is a great time in your life to focus on eating healthy and exercising regularly. Also, studies show that exercising regularly keeps you happier, so why say no to that?

6. Connect with people all the time.


Don't lose touch with the people you know. Keep up with high school and college friends, and don’t let your distant family members become strangers. Pick up the phone and talk to people when you have free time; take them out for coffee. Ask them how they’re doing, what they’re up to—it will go a long way. Call an old friend just to say hi, call grandma to tell her you miss her—keep in touch with everyone, always.

7. Get an experience instead of an object.

You might think that your next paycheck should be going towards that new bag you saw in the window walking to work, or those new beautiful shoes you think you must have. Instead, try saving money for a trip, or a concert or a show. Become accustomed to buying experiences rather than objects, because while that newest bag or pair of shoes will make you happy for a while, experiences will stay with you forever.

8. Learn to cook.

Enough of the Kraft Mac 'n' Cheese or buttered and salted pasta for dinner—invest in a cookbook and learn some new recipes! Be able to surprise guests when you have them over for dinner. Explore foods you have yet to try or make before.

9. Set goals.

Setting realistic goals will help you achieve not only everything you want to, but also keep you productive each and every day. Setting goals and working towards them is a great way to accomplish things you really want to do.

10. Put your phone down.

It is time for the cheesy quote: "look up." Everyone is becoming so accustomed to spending every single second looking at Instagram or Facebook to see the newest update from someone they probably don't even speak to. You will be surprised how much more you get out of each day with less time spent on your phone. Put it down and be in the moment!

11. Realize who your true best friends are.

Life is too short to surround yourself with people who don’t really care about you or believe in you. At this point in your life, it is easy to tell which of your friends care about you and love you, and they are the ones worth hanging on to and making memories with. Keep them by your side for love and support.


Your 20's are the years that help shape the person that you will become. It is so important to take advantage of them and try to lead the most positive and healthy lifestyle you possibly can.
